Manager, Cloud Engineering

First Advantage Global operating CentreUS_Florida_Virtual, FL
$140,000 - $160,000

About The Position

The Manager, Cloud Engineering is responsible for leading the design, implementation, governance, and ongoing optimization of secure, scalable, and highly available cloud solutions across both Microsoft Azure and Amazon Web Services (AWS). This is a hands-on technical leadership role responsible for both managing a small team of cloud engineers and actively contributing as an individual contributor to cloud engineering, automation, and operational work. This role partners closely with architecture, information security, and engineering teams to ensure cloud platforms align with enterprise standards, security best practices, and business objectives. The ideal candidate brings deep hands-on cloud engineering expertise, a strong automation mindset, and proven experience leading and mentoring engineers in modern DevOps and Agile environments while remaining directly involved in day-to-day technical execution.

Requirements

  • For compliance reasons, all personnel must be United States Citizens and have, for 3 of the past 5 years, resided in the United States OR worked for the United States overseas in a federal or military capacity OR be a dependent of a federal or military employee serving overseas.
  • In addition to our standard pre-employment background check and drug screen, you will be required to undergo additional checks to obtain an LAR certification via the the proper channels in order to be in this role.
  • 7+ years of experience working in an Agile, software development, and DevOps-oriented environment, with a strong hands-on engineering background and a focus on operational automation.
  • Prior experience in a hands-on technical leadership or management role, leading a small team while remaining actively involved in engineering work.
  • Demonstrated, hands-on experience with both Microsoft Azure and Amazon Web Services (AWS) in enterprise production environments.
  • Strong expertise in at least two of the following programming languages: C#, Java or other JVM-based languages, JavaScript/Node.js, TypeScript, or Python.
  • Proficiency with scripting languages such as PowerShell and Bash for automation, tooling, and CI/CD orchestration.
  • Extensive Infrastructure as Code (IaC) experience using tools such as Bicep, ARM Templates, Terraform, Azure CLI, Azure PowerShell, Azure SDKs, AWS CloudFormation, and AWS CLI/SDKs.
  • Experience designing, implementing, and supporting CI/CD pipelines using tools such as Jenkins or GitHub Actions.
  • Strong experience with core Azure services, including but not limited to: Container Apps, Azure Storage (Blob), Virtual Networks and NSGs, Application Gateway / Front Door, RBAC and Microsoft Entra ID, Azure Functions, Azure Policy, Azure Key Vault
  • Strong experience with core AWS services, including but not limited to: ECS, S3, VPC, CloudFront, ELB, EC2, Lambda

Nice To Haves

  • Experience with Azure security and governance capabilities such as Management Groups, Landing Zones, Azure Policy, Defender for Cloud, Azure Update Management, Automation, and Azure Arc.
  • Experience designing and implementing highly available, resilient, and secure cloud architectures in Azure and AWS.

Responsibilities

  • Design, build, and implement scalable, secure, and highly available cloud solutions across Azure and AWS to meet business and technical requirements.
  • Remain hands-on with cloud engineering work, including infrastructure design, automation, troubleshooting, and production support.
  • Govern, manage, and maintain SaaS platforms and cloud services within Azure and AWS environments.
  • Automate and streamline cloud infrastructure provisioning and operations using scripting, configuration management, and Infrastructure as Code (IaC) tools.
  • Monitor cloud environments and proactively troubleshoot, diagnose, and resolve cloud-related issues in a timely and effective manner.
  • Automate common operational tasks to increase reliability, reduce toil, and improve overall operational efficiency.
  • Manage, optimize, and continuously improve cloud resource utilization to ensure cost efficiency and performance optimization.
  • Lead, coach, and manage a small team of cloud engineers, providing technical guidance, mentorship, and performance management.
  • Set clear technical direction and expectations while actively working alongside the team on engineering initiatives.
  • Foster a culture of operational excellence, automation, continuous improvement, and shared ownership.
  • Support career development by providing regular feedback, technical mentorship, and opportunities for skill growth.
  • Collaborate with enterprise architecture and information security teams to design, implement, and enforce cloud security policies, standards, and procedures.
  • Implement and maintain cloud security best practices to ensure protection of company systems, resources, and data.
  • Partner closely with application and platform engineering teams to ensure cloud solutions integrate seamlessly with enterprise architecture and service standards.
  • Contribute to the development, documentation, and evolution of enterprise cloud standards, reference architectures, and best practices.
  • Participate in a 24x7 on-call rotation and provide occasional after-hours support as required.
  • Act as an escalation point for complex cloud-related incidents and technical challenges.

Benefits

  • Professional development opportunities, such as our award-winning SOAR program
  • Generous Paid Time Off Program
  • Volunteer Time Off (VTO) Policy to encourage involvement in philanthropic activities
  • Competitive benefits (medical, dental, etc.)
  • Global Employee Assistance Program (EAP) available to all team members
  • Opportunities to connect with colleagues across six Employee Impact Groups and participate in Employee Experience events throughout the year
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service